DTC P0A1F-123: Battery Energy Control Module: Procedure

  1. CHECK AUXILIARY BATTERY 
    1. Measure the voltage between the terminals of the auxiliary battery.

      Standard voltage

      11 to 14 V

    NG → CHARGE OR REPLACE AUXILIARY BATTERY 

    OK: Go to next step 

  2. CHECK HARNESS AND CONNECTOR (IGCT VOLTAGE) 
    WARNING:

    Be sure to wear insulated gloves.

    1. Disconnect the cable from the negative (-) battery terminal.
    2. Check that the service plug grip is not installed.
      NOTE:

      After removing the service plug grip, do not turn the power switch on (READY), unless instructed by the repair manual because this may cause a malfunction.

    3. Remove the hybrid battery junction block assembly.
    4. Disconnect the z15 connector from the battery smart unit.

    5. Connect the cable to the negative (-) battery terminal.
    6. Turn the power switch on (IG).
    7. Measure the voltage according to the value(s) in the table below.

      Standard Voltage

      Tester Connection Switch Condition Specified Condition
      z15-1 (IGCT) - z15-5 (GND) Power switch on (IG) 8.6 V or higher
      NOTE:
      • After removing the service plug grip, do not turn the power switch on (READY), unless instructed by the repair manual because this may cause a malfunction.
      • Turning the power switch on (IG) with the service plug grip removed causes DTCs to be set. Use the Techstream to clear the DTCs.

    8. Turn the power switch off.
    9. Connect the z15 connector to the battery smart unit
    10. Install the hybrid battery junction block assembly.

    NG → See step   3 

    OK → See step   6 

  3. CHECK FUSE (IGCT, IGCT NO. 2) 
    1. Turn the power switch off.
    2. Remove the IGCT and IGCT No. 2 fuses from the engine room junction block assembly.

    3. Measure the resistance according to the value(s) in the table below.

      Standard Resistance

      Tester Connection Condition Specified Condition
      IGCT fuse Always Below 1 Ω
      IGCT No. 2 fuse Always Below 1 Ω
    4. Install the IGCT and IGCT No. 2 fuses to the engine room junction block assembly.

    NG → REPLACE FUSE (IGCT, IGCT NO. 2) 

    OK: Go to next step 

  4. CHECK RELAY (IGCT) 
    1. Turn the power switch off.
    2. Remove the IGCT relay from the engine room junction block assembly.

    3. Measure the resistance according to the value(s) in the table below.

      Standard Resistance

      Tester Connection Condition Specified Condition
      3 - 5 Auxiliary battery voltage is applied between terminals 1 and 2 below 1 Ω
      Auxiliary battery voltage is not applied between terminals 1 and 2 10 kΩ or more
    4. Install the IGCT relay to the engine room junction block assembly.

    NG → REPLACE RELAY (IGCT) 

    OK: Go to next step 

  5. CHECK HARNESS AND CONNECTOR (IGCT RELAY - BATTERY SMART UNIT) 
    WARNING:

    Be sure to wear insulated gloves.

    1. Disconnect the cable from the negative (-) battery terminal.
    2. Remove the IGCT relay from the engine room junction block assembly.

    3. Check that the service plug grip is not installed.
      NOTE:

      After removing the service plug grip, do not turn the power switch on (READY), unless instructed by the repair manual because this may cause a malfunction.

    4. Remove the hybrid battery junction block assembly.
    5. Disconnect only the z15 connector of the battery smart unit.

    6. Measure the resistance according to the value(s) in the table below.

      Standard Resistance

      Tester Connection Switch Condition Specified Condition
      IGCT relay terminal 5 - z15-4 (IGCT) Power switch off Below 1 Ω

    7. Connect the z15 connector of the battery smart unit.
    8. Install the hybrid battery junction block assembly.
    9. Install the IGCT relay to the engine room junction block assembly.
    10. Connect the cable to the negative (-) battery terminal.

    NG → REPAIR OR REPLACE HARNESS OR CONNECTOR 

    OK → CHECK AND REPAIR POWER SOURCE CIRCUIT 

  6. REPLACE BATTERY SMART UNIT. Refer to  REMOVAL
